Your landlord's policy covers the building — it does nothing for your belongings, your liability, or your living expenses if a fire or other disaster forces you out. For the price of a few coffees a month, a renters policy covers all three.
Renters policies exclude flood and earthquake, the same as homeowners policies, and don't cover your roommate's property unless they're named on the policy. Standard limits on high-value categories like jewelry and electronics are low, so schedule anything valuable. Damage to the building itself is the landlord's responsibility, not yours.
Renters insurance is one of the cheapest policies you can buy. Price depends on your coverage amount, deductible, location, and whether you add replacement-cost or scheduled valuables. Bundling with an auto policy frequently produces a discount that offsets much or all of the renters premium.
Estimate the cost to replace everything you own — most people are surprised how quickly furniture, clothing, and electronics add up — and insure to that amount with replacement-cost coverage. Carry at least $100,000 in liability (often $300,000), and schedule any single item worth more than your policy's per-item limit.
If you have a loss, the sooner you report it the better. Document everything first: photos or video of the damage, a written inventory of what was lost, receipts or estimates, and a copy of any police, fire, or incident report. Report the claim to the carrier (we can file it with you), and an adjuster is then assigned to review the facts, inspect the damage, and confirm what the policy covers. You pay your deductible; the insurer pays the covered balance up to your limits. Keep damaged property until the adjuster releases it, make reasonable temporary repairs to prevent further loss, and keep the receipts — those emergency-mitigation costs are usually reimbursable. Washington is an at-fault (tort) state, which means the driver or party responsible for an accident is liable for the resulting injuries and damage — making adequate liability and uninsured-motorist limits especially important. Insurance here is regulated by the Washington State Office of the Insurance Commissioner, which oversees carriers and consumer protections and has limited the use of credit-based insurance scoring in pricing. On the property side, standard home policies exclude both earthquake and flood — meaningful given Cascadia seismic risk and river flooding — so those perils are covered, if at all, by separate policies.

| Coverage | What it does |
|---|---|
| Personal property | Replaces belongings after theft, fire, or covered damage |
| Personal liability | Defends you if you are held responsible for injury/damage |
| Guest medical | Minor medical costs for a guest hurt in your unit |
| Loss of use (ALE) | Pays for temporary housing after a covered loss |
| Scheduled items | Extra coverage for jewelry, cameras, electronics |
